Abstract

Production machines play an important role in maintaining the quality and efficiency of output, so they require special attention and regular maintenance to extend their service life. PT. XYZ is one of the companies engaged in the cement industry in Indonesia, with a production capacity of 29 million tons per year. The production system implemented is a continuous process, where all machines must be in optimal condition so as not to disrupt production and avoid potential losses. Based on the observation results, the production process with the highest downtime rate occurs in the packer area, with the Roto Packer 638PM1 machine as the largest contributor to downtime. Currently, the company is implementing a corrective and preventive maintenance system, but the implementation of preventive maintenance is still not optimal. Therefore, this study aims to propose a preventive maintenance system with a modular design approach and ABC (Always Better Control) classification. The combination of machine criticality assessment and the level of use of each component is expected to increase operational efficiency, reduce the risk of production disruption due to the scarcity of important components, and reduce inefficient storage costs. Through the application of this method, the total maintenance cost obtained is IDR 771,782,456, or IDR 406,113,204 lower than the current cost of IDR 1,177,895,660. With an efficiency reaching 34.47%, this method is considered feasible to be implemented by the company.
